Why Water Testing in Houston Is Essential
Houston's water supply comes from a combination of surface water and groundwater sources. While municipal treatment facilities work to meet safety standards, various factors such as aging infrastructure, industrial pollution, and natural contaminants can still impact water quality by the time it reaches your tap. Some of the most common issues found in Houston water include:
- Heavy Metals – Lead, arsenic, and mercury can leach from pipes and soil into the water supply.
- Bacteria and Viruses – Harmful microorganisms can pose significant health risks, especially to individuals with weakened immune systems.
- Chlorine and Chloramines – While these disinfectants help eliminate bacteria, they can also create harmful byproducts.
- Hard Water Minerals – Excessive calcium and magnesium can lead to scale buildup in plumbing and appliances.
- Chemical Contaminants – Pesticides, herbicides, and industrial chemicals may find their way into groundwater and drinking water sources.

The Advantages of Professional Water Testing Services
Many people assume that if their water looks clear and tastes fine, it must be safe. However, many contaminants are invisible and tasteless, making professional testing the only reliable way to detect potential issues. Water testing services offer several key benefits when handled by professionals
1. Comprehensive and Accurate Analysis
Unlike at-home test kits, professional water testing provides precise and detailed results. Experts use advanced laboratory techniques to analyze a broad range of contaminants, ensuring that nothing is overlooked. This level of accuracy is essential for making informed decisions about water treatment solutions.
2. Identifying Health Risks
Contaminated water can cause a variety of health issues, from gastrointestinal problems to long-term illnesses like kidney disease and cancer. A thorough water test can detect harmful substances such as bacteria, lead, nitrates, and volatile organic compounds (VOCs). Knowing what’s in your water allows you to take appropriate action to protect your family’s health.
3. Improving Taste and Odor
Unpleasant tastes and odors in water are often caused by chlorine, sulfur, or organic matter. By conducting a professional water test, you can pinpoint the source of these issues and implement the necessary filtration or purification systems to improve water quality.
4. Protecting Plumbing and Appliances
Hard water minerals and corrosive chemicals can lead to scale buildup, pipe damage, and reduced efficiency of water-using appliances. Water testing helps identify these problems early, allowing homeowners to install water softeners or filtration systems to extend the lifespan of their plumbing and appliances.
5. Ensuring Compliance for Businesses
For commercial establishments such as restaurants, medical facilities, and industrial plants, maintaining high water quality standards is essential. Professional water testing ensures compliance with local and federal regulations, helping businesses avoid legal issues and potential health risks for customers and employees.
How Often Should You Test Your Water?
The frequency of water quality testing depends on several factors, including water source, location, and any previous contamination history. Here are some general guidelines:
- Well Water Users: Test at least once a year for bacteria, nitrates, and other common contaminants.
- Municipal Water Users: Even if your water is supplied by the city, it's advisable to test annually to check for chlorine levels, lead, and other pollutants.
- Households with Health Concerns: If someone in your household has a compromised immune system, more frequent testing may be necessary.
- After Plumbing Repairs or Water Treatment Installations: Anytime your plumbing is serviced or a new filtration system is installed, testing ensures that everything is functioning correctly.
